求教做过JPEG解码的高手一个sos段后的信息的问题(悬赏)

求教做过JPEG解码的高手一个sos段后的信息的问题(悬赏)FFDA/000C/0301/0002/1103/1100/3F00/EE2695268D676B38B6CBF37CFB8E7E833D29B2CF1BC7E5B5ADAB6EE8006DBF906A865C336F7270157CB8CF18E9D0FD377E551B451B9123A96CB742B935E2DD9BD8B51DE4064F24DBC3C11C6187F5E3EB55DB54B7DED88E0033D95DBF50D83552E6592DE75985B0C6DC33C7BB81CFA9C74ED551A4476DC2284EEE7E66553F976A7CE4356243A8C725F246D011E622EE25B8638F6FA56A1913F74EAA223F7731E187EB54E68A2C44FE5AE4DBAB1E3BE40FC3A9E9576C4F9EAF11014470EF52BD473D327B516B157B097AA92C1B4F9B1E79F32238CFAE783558F911FCA57791DCE39A9A6665B3BD3B8929180A4F3B73BB381D3B0A8AD360B700C48D8661939CFDE3EF4D2435AA3F/FFD9
以上是SOS(start of scan)段的信息,以及到JPEG文件结束标志(FFD9),红色字体部分我都能看懂,jpeg解码原理我都懂,但是SOS段后面的数据是一个怎么样的组织结构呢???比如我想取出一个MCU该怎么取?有什么标志没?(找了很多资料都没有介绍的!!哭了!!
求教高手啊!!!!!!!!!!!!!!!!
我也来说两句 查看全部回复

最新回复

  • liu851104 (2008-11-20 18:44:59)

    我想了解的是:在JPEG图片的0XFFDA数据段后(也就是Start Of Scan段) 接下来的就是一个个扫描行,我的理解就是紧跟着SOS段后的数据就应该是 每一个8*8数据块经过量化 DCT转换以及HUFFMAN编码后的bit流, 我不太清楚的就是若干个bits流是怎么存放的? 并且在一个8*8数据块编码后的bit流中单个数据之间怎么划分 比如:我的图像大小为31×41那么我要分几个MCU(16×16的块)来编码,以及编码后的bit流怎么个存储结构呢——也就是SOS段后面的那段数据